Description. Test small and fragile test, up to 12 mm long. Genital and ocular plates fused, with four gonopores (Fig. 2 c). Ocular pores smaller than gonopores. Only one hydropore on the apical system. Petals distinct and open distally. Periproct very small, located halfway between peristome and posterior margin of test (Fig. 2 d). Oral side slightly depressed around peristome (Fig. 2 d).

Distribution. Atlantic Ocean: south of Svalbard, Norwegian Sea, North Sea, west of Iceland, United Kingdom, English Channel, Ireland, Bay of Biscay, west and north Galicia, Azores, south of Portugal, west Africa, Mediterranean Sea (O. F. Müller, 1776; Mortensen, 1927; Schultz, 2005; Kroh, & Mooi, 2022; OBIS, 2022) Bathymetrical range. 0 m (Mortensen, 1903) – 1250 m (Mortensen, 1927). Present study: 1313 m.

Habitat: lives buried in soft substrates, in sand, detritic and gravelly bottoms where it feeds on detritus and foraminifera (Koehler 1898, Picton 1993). Larval stage: planktotrophic (Mortensen 1927 a).

Description: test small, flattened, variable in form; outline generally elongated oval, though among the smallest specimens frequently ellipsoid (width = 66 – 74 % TL; TL <3 mm) becoming more circular or subpentagonal in larger individuals (width = 100 % TL; TL Ξ 7 mm). Apical disc central to slightly posterior, with large genital pores and five small ocular pores. The lower half of the apical side locally depressed in larger individuals (TL = 7 – 8 mm). Oral area mostly flat; depression between the peristome and periproct particularly evident in the larger specimens (TL> 5 mm). Peristome circular to subpentangular, relatively concave; diameter of the peristome about 30 – 33 % TL in smaller individuals (TL <3 mm) decreasing to 13 – 19 % TL in larger specimens (TL Ξ 7 mm). Periproct ellipsoid to round, small (6 – 12 % TL) lies halfway between the peristome and the posterior margin. Petals well developed, but not reaching the edge of the test; pore-series almost parallel, open distally, reaching ten pore pairs per column in the posterior ambulacra in the largest specimens (TL = 7 – 8 mm). Spines short, relatively uniform. Colour (in ethanol): test and spines white or cream, occasionally green.

Fossil record: also reported from the Pliocene and Pleistocene outcrops of Santa Maria Island (Madeira et al. 2011, 2017 a).
